Chen On Mon, Jan 30, 2017 at 4:06 PM, Ian Maxon <[email protected]> wrote: > Hey all, > Once Gerrit is actually upgraded (hopefully tonight) you should go > ahead and link a Google or Github account to your existing account > that uses a Yahoo ID. From that point on you can sign in via that auth > method and not bother with Yahoo anymore. > > Firstly, however, when the upgraded site comes online, _DON'T_ try to > login via Google/Gerrit if you already have an account on Gerrit. This > creates two accounts! What you really want is to link your > Google/Github identity to your existing account. > > To be able to login via Google/Github without creating two accounts, > log in with your Yahoo ID as normal once the upgrade is finished, then > click your name in the top right hand corner and go to "Settings". > Then, on the left hand side go to "Identities". Then, click the 'Link > Another Identity" button on the right hand side. This will take you to > the login screen again, but this time instead of using your Yahoo ID, > just login with Google or Github and you will have added that as a way > to log into your account. > > For those that remember, this is basically the same process we had > when Google deprecated OpenID, just in reverse this time around. > > Thanks, > - Ian >
